IHD Knoxfield: Profile
   

Name: Phil M
Role: Team Leader Information Technology - Institute Services 
Location: Institute for Horticultural Development Knoxfield

ABOUT MY CAREER 

What is Information Technology? 
»The use of technology such as computers, electronics and telecommunications to communicate information

What does a typical day in your job involve? 
»Managing the information technology systems within the Institute. 

»Provide software and helpdesk support to staff at the Institute. This can include training, fixing faults in the system and repairing hardware. 

»Planning new hardware installations, system upgrades and software development. 

What do you enjoy most about your job? 
»I enjoy working with hardware and related components, as well as creating web-sites and information resources.

Why did you choose this career?
»I started my career in the area of amenity horticulture and worked for several years as a nurseryman / parks and gardens foreman 

»I was interested in furthering my interest in electronics and technology in the area of control systems and glasshouse automation 

»This led me to work at the institute where I started working as a technical officer 

»I then completed a post-graduate course in computer science and become involved in the delivery of the information technology support to the institute 

»With the rapid growth of information technology services at the institute the opportunity arose for me to work in this position full time 

What would you like to do in the future? 
»I would like to move into project management 

A LITTLE BIT ABOUT MYSELF 

Where did you grow up? 
»I grew up in the Melbourne suburb of Ashburton 

How did this influence your choice of career?
»I don't think where I grew up had much impact on my chosen career 

MY EDUCATION AND TRAINING 

Were courses in secondary school planned for this sort of work?
»While at school I was interested in biological sciences and chemistry, although at the time I had no particular direction in mind. 

Which University or TAFE course have you completed?
»Diploma of Horticultural Science at VCAH Burnley 

»Graduate Diploma of Computer Science at Swinburne University 

FUTURE OPPORTUNITIES 

Do you plan to do further study? 
»Balancing work and parenting roles is a challenge and while opportunities do exist to pursue further studies these are on hold for the moment. 

Is there a lot of learning on the job? 
»As information technology is rapidly changing over time and new technologies are always being developed I am continuously learning on the job. 

Do you travel much in your job?
»Opportunities do exist to travel to conferences as well as attending regional meetings around the state. 

What are graduates from you course doing now?
»Consulting 

»Retail 

ADVICE TO STUDENTS NOW 

Primary students
»Investigate new technology and search the web 

»Learn to touch type 

Secondary students
»Pursue the use of information technology to meet the needs of your courses whether in the arts or sciences. Help your teachers catch up!
